Официальное название

Phase I/IIa Study to Evaluate the Safety, Tolerability, and Efficacy of EPI-001 in Patients With Androgenetic Alopecia

Обзор

This is a Phase I/IIa clinical study to evaluate the safety, tolerability, and preliminary efficacy of EPI-001 in patients with androgenetic alopecia. In the Phase I portion, a traditional 3+3 dose-escalation design will be used to determine the maximum tolerated dose (MTD) and recommended Phase 2 dose (RP2D) of EPI-001. Subjects will be followed for up to 24 weeks after administration. In the Phase IIa portion, subjects will be randomized in a 2:1 ratio to receive either EPI-001 or placebo. Safety and efficacy will be evaluated through hair count assessment, hair diameter measurement, clinical photography, investigator assessment, expert panel assessment, and subject self-assessment during a follow-up period of up to 48 weeks.

Подробное описание

Androgenetic alopecia (AGA) is one of the most common forms of hair loss in both men and women and is characterized by progressive hair follicle miniaturization associated with androgen sensitivity and genetic predisposition. Current treatment options for AGA are limited and may not provide sufficient therapeutic benefit for all patients.

EPI-001 is an autologous dermal papilla cell therapy intended for the treatment of androgenetic alopecia. This study is designed to evaluate the safety, tolerability, and efficacy of EPI-001 in subjects with androgenetic alopecia.

This study consists of two parts: a Phase I dose-escalation study and a Phase IIa dose-expansion study.

In the Phase I portion, subjects will receive a single administration of EPI-001 using a traditional 3+3 dose-escalation design to evaluate dose-limiting toxicity (DLT), determine the maximum tolerated dose (MTD), and establish the recommended Phase 2 dose (RP2D). Subjects will be followed for up to 24 weeks after administration.

In the Phase IIa portion, eligible subjects will be randomized in a 2:1 ratio to receive either EPI-001 at the RP2D or placebo. The study will evaluate efficacy through changes in total hair count and hair diameter, as well as investigator assessment, expert panel assessment based on clinical photographs, and subject self-assessment questionnaires. Subjects will undergo follow-up assessments for up to 48 weeks after administration.

Вмешательства

  • Биопрепарат EPI-001
    EPI-001 is an autologous dermal papilla cell-based investigational product administered by subcutaneous injection to the scalp for the treatment of androgenetic alopecia.
  • Другое Placebo
    Placebo control administered by subcutaneous injection to the scalp.

Первичные конечные точки

  • Incidence of Dose-Limiting Toxicities [Срок оценки: Up to 4 weeks after administration]
Вторичные конечные точки (8)
  • Incidence of Adverse Events and Local Adverse Events [Срок оценки: Phase I: up to 24 weeks; Phase IIa: up to 48 weeks after administration]
  • Number of Participants With Clinically Significant Abnormal Vital Signs [Срок оценки: Phase I: up to 24 weeks; Phase IIa: up to 48 weeks after administration]
  • Number of Participants With Clinically Significant Laboratory Abnormalities [Срок оценки: Phase I: up to 24 weeks; Phase IIa: up to 48 weeks after administration]
  • Investigator Assessment of Hair Growth Improvement Based on Clinical Photographs Using a 7-Point Scale [Срок оценки: Phase I: Weeks 4, 12, and 24; Phase IIa: Weeks 12, 24, 36, and 48]
  • Subject Self-Assessment of Hair Growth Improvement Using a 7-Point Questionnaire Scale [Срок оценки: Phase I: Weeks 4, 12, and 24; Phase IIa: Weeks 12, 24, 36, and 48]
  • Change From Baseline in Total Hair Count Assessed by Phototrichogram [Срок оценки: Phase I: Week 24; Phase IIa: Weeks 12, 24, and 48]
  • Change From Baseline in Mean Hair Diameter Assessed by Phototrichogram [Срок оценки: Phase I: Week 24; Phase IIa: Weeks 12, 24, and 48]
  • Expert Panel Assessment of Hair Growth Improvement Based on Clinical Photographs Using a 7-Point Scale [Срок оценки: Phase IIa: Weeks 12, 24, 36, and 48]

Критерии участия

Критерии включения

  • Male or female subjects aged 19 years or older
  • Subjects diagnosed with androgenetic alopecia
  • Subjects willing to maintain the same hairstyle, hair length, and hair color during the study period
  • Subjects willing to refrain from prohibited hair-related products or procedures during the study period
  • Subjects willing to undergo scalp tattooing and hair trimming for phototrichogram evaluation
  • Subjects who voluntarily signed written informed consent

Критерии исключения

  • Subjects who used prohibited medications or therapies affecting hair growth within the protocol-defined period
  • Subjects with scalp diseases or hair disorders other than androgenetic alopecia
  • Subjects with autoimmune diseases affecting the scalp or hair
  • Subjects with clinically significant cardiovascular, renal, endocrine, infectious, or systemic diseases
  • Subjects positive for HBV, HCV, HIV, or syphilis screening tests
  • Subjects with a history of hair transplantation, stem cell therapy, or gene therapy
  • Subjects with hypersensitivity related to the investigational product or study procedures
  • Pregnant or breastfeeding women
  • Subjects who participated in another clinical study within the protocol-defined period
  • Subjects judged inappropriate for study participation by the investigator
